The National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ST), under the Department of Commerce, is soliciting quotes for two Optical Atomic Clock Systems to be deployed in Gaithersburg, Maryland, for integration into an auxiliary timescale. This Request for Quotation, identified by solicitation number NB688000-26-02390, is issued as a combined synopsis and solicitation with a small business set-aside designation, fully reserved for small businesses. The requirement, classified under NAICS code 334519, demands systems capable of precise timekeeping standards to support NIST’s metrology mission. All submissions must reference the solicitation number, and responses are due by August 21, 2026, at 5:00 PM ET. Cabin Pressure Tester Set
Solicitation # W50S8U-26-Q-A014
The Oklahoma Air National Guard is soliciting quotes under a Full and Open Competition for a Firm-Fixed-Price contract to procure one Tronair Cabin Pressure Test Set, model 15-7609-6000-FJ, and one Nano Water Separator Assembly with integrated Nano Filter, part number GF0175M01. The equipment must meet strict technical specifications outlined in a System Engineering MEMO dated June 30, 2025, including continuous duty air supply at 110 SCFM at 100 psi minimum up to 150 psi maximum, certified gauges for cabin, system, and door seal pressure, detachable hoses of specified lengths, an on-board battery charger compatible with 120 to 240 VAC power, and an ATA transport case with wheels and retractable handle. The test set must include F-16 specific adapter hoses and an inline air filter with the exact Nano purification component. The Nano Water Separator must be manufactured from die-cast aluminum with polyester powder coating, produced in an ISO 9001 certified facility, tested per ISO 12500-4, and rated for 175 SCFM flow. All proposals must include a written explanation demonstrating full compliance with each salient characteristic, and quotes are due by August 20, 2026, at 3:00 PM ET, submitted via email to 138.FW.MSC@us.af.mil. Delivery is required to Tulsa, OK 74115. This solicitation is a Small Business Set Aside under NAICS code 334519, and only responsive offers that conform exactly to the requirements will be considered for award.
